Elden Ring Mod Adds Avatar: The Last Airbender's Firebending

While the world lacks a modern, official Avatar: The Last Airbender game, a new Elden Ring mod at least lets players pretend by adding firebending to the game.

As reported by PCGamesN, the firebending moveset mod from clevererraptor6 on Nexus Mods takes inspiration straight from the show, letting the player shoot fire from their finger tips, and even includes a “lightning generation” Ash of War for the most skilled fighters.

Available with the standard red flames or in Princess Azula’s blue, the mod includes several different attacks depending on the input, and sound effects for each.

While pyromancy is already an established idea in Elden Ring, these attacks are directly inspired by the Avatar series and fans will recognise certain movements and combos as a result. There are plenty of little details that show clevererraptor6 is committed to authenticity – for example ensuring that the explosions caused by blue fire attacks still explode in red flames, as they do in the show.

With firebending now in Elden Ring, fans are also eager to see the remaining elements – air, water, and earth – added as well, but cleverraptor6 has yet to say if they’re working on these too.

Seeing Avatar combat in a modern game will leave many begging for a new, official game. There hasn’t been one since 2014’s Legend of Korra, and it didn’t receive a positive response – in our 4/10 review, IGN said: “Even with a reputable developer behind it, The Legend of Korra game left us bent out of shape.”
